Understanding Plan Templates in Strategy Overview

Plan templates provide pre-built structures for the flexible planning module. Use plan templates to create implementation roadmaps, onboarding checklists, project plans, and strategic initiatives.

How Plan Templates Work

Plan templates define content for the flexible planning module. When you create a plan from a template or apply a template to an existing plan, the system copies that content into your plan.

Updates don't flow to existing plans: Changes to a plan template only affect new plans created from that template. Plans you've already created won't receive updates from the template. This gives you complete control over each plan's content without worrying about template changes affecting work in progress.

How to Use Plan Templates

Create a new plan from a template: When creating a new plan, select a plan template. The system copies the template content into your new plan.

Apply a template to an existing plan: Add content from a plan template to a plan you're already working on. The template content appends to the end of your existing plan.

Customizing Plan Templates

Access plan templates at Settings > Plan Templates.

Remember: Changes to plan templates only affect new plans created from that template. Existing plans won't receive updates when you modify a plan template.
